    So my x8 went down this afternoon and I think it is the same thing that happened to Josh and a few other people who had their copters crash. It starts an uncontrolled yaw then slowly gets worse then it started doing the death wobble dance just like Josh's did in the video he posted. I remember everyone blamed a2 when these crashes happened and some blamed Kde until someone had the same crash happen with a wkm and tiger motors. Mine was with a wkm and Kde motors. Thoughts?

    I think 5.26 has known issues and the last known good firmware is 5.20. I know Michael can expound on this much better.

    We fly one on 5.16 and another on 5.20. Those are both tried and true firmwares - both according to many people that fly them frequently and we have been flying a couple Cinestars on those firmwares for well over a year. We also fly the v2 IMU with them.
